James Thompson Violin
James Thompson
Full size
Bearing label "James Thompson, Maker, Old Heston, 1840". This violin is in original condition, and is the earliest known example from this, the most northern English maker. We have handled several of Thompson's viols, and this is the earliest one we have seen. This is a simple, honest violin, prior to his adoption of the long pattern Strad. A two piece back of local, bird's eye maple, with ribs and neck of similar wood. Front of fine grained pine. Inked purfling, and an attractive red varnish.
